Why We Need Both 40G and 100G Ethernet Cable?
Ethernet has always moved in 10x increments from 10Mb > 100Mb > 1Gb > 1oGb. Below is a 2007 IEEE forecast of server adoption of Ethernet Connections. While the standard for 10Gb Ethernet was ratified in 2002, it wasn’t until 2007 server adoption began and it was 2009/2010 before we saw significant customer deployments in their datacenters and servers.
IEEE prediction from April 2007
Server Bus architectures must also mature to take advantage of the high bandwidth interconnection. This led to the idea to create 100Gb for the core (between switches) and 40Gb for the distribution/aggregation (pedestal/rack/blade servers to switches).
As for the uses for these speeds, it is the next generation of servers which are characterized by dense computing and high utilization through virtualization which will use 40Gb and 100Gb will enable the success of 10Gb servers.
